- website server lookup history
- www.aipkcq3.com
- www.692323.com
- info.envestnet.com
- liushizupu.com
- qh.huaguiedu.com
- imsobrr.com
- www.cnship.com
- www.zhsz.org
- qywzdyy.com
- www.haidemed.com
- ahwenfeng.com
- shnei.com
- gaysex.com
- www.tokyohot.com
- m.hg6668888.com
- h5.hegschuangtuo.com
- www.puchao.com
- wwwyw3119.com
- shzhenanxf.com
- bfxt23g.huaguiedu.com
- hosting ip address lookup history
- 155.159.187.212
- 8.210.108.21
- 35.213.164.182
- 154.201.243.243
- 123.184.16.132
- 45.196.120.197
- 175.29.150.136
- 156.254.219.25
- 51.255.62.16
- 103.133.179.68
- 156.235.151.60
- 118.178.178.178
- 162.125.32.10
- 213.162.209.140
- 45.201.226.74
- 154.86.170.44
- 209.221.27.69
- 206.238.4.241
- 154.85.155.78
- 154.206.152.213
